Ammonia emissions were measured for six months at a modern 250,000-hen high-rise egg laying house using the chemiluminescence method along with multi-point extractive gas sampling. The ammonia analyzer was sequenced through twelve sampling locations including nine exhaust fans every two hours and calibrated at least weekly with certified calibration gases. Ammonia gas is the only significant basic gas that neutralizes atmospheric acid gases produced from combustion of fossil fuels. This reaction produces an aerosol that is a component of atmospheric haze, is implicated in nitrogen (N) deposition, and may be a potential human health hazard.
